<H2>Python OSA architecture</H2>
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
Open Scripting suites and inheritance can be modelled rather nicely with
|
||||||
|
with Python packages, so for each application we want to script we generate
|
||||||
|
a package. Each suite defined in the application becomes a module in the
|
||||||
|
package, and the package main module imports everything from all the
|
||||||
|
submodules and glues all the classes (Python terminology, OSA terminology is
|
||||||
|
events, AppleScript terminology is verbs) together. <p>
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
A suite in an OSA application can extend the functionality of a standard
|
||||||
|
suite, and this is implemented in Python by importing everything from the
|
||||||
|
module that implements the standard suite and overriding anything that has
|
||||||
|
been extended. The standard suites live in the StdSuite package. <p>
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
This all sounds complicated, and you can do strange and wondrous things
|
||||||
|
with it once you fully understand it, but the good news is that simple
|
||||||
|
scripting is actually pretty simple. <p>
